Sonic was recognized for its enterprise service bus product Sonic ESB(R), which is the foundation of the Sonic SOA Suite(TM), a comprehensive infrastructure platform for service-oriented architecture (SOA). Network Magazine's "Most Influential" Innovation Award is given to the technologies and products that "have the greatest and most immediate impact on their markets." "Network Magazine's mission is to look beyond the technologies and methodologies that are hot today, concentrating instead on the architectures that will dominate IT a couple years from now," said Art Wittmann, editor-in-chief, Network Magazine. "Given that, the winners of the 2005 Innovation Awards are true innovators that we believe will change the rules of the game. These are innovations that will enable IT organizations to substantially better meet the needs of their business." In selecting Sonic ESB as the "Most Influential" product from a group of over 200 entrants, Network Magazine wrote, "The main trend in data center software is the shift toward a Service-Oriented Architecture (SOA). The most influential player here is Sonic Software." "Sonic is honored to be singled out as the most influential innovator of infrastructure software by Network Magazine," said Greg O'Connor, president of Sonic Software.
